Showtime Flag Football Heats Up! LA Knights Remain Undefeated As Six Teams Scramble for Playoff Glory In Week 08–09 Showdowns

The Showtime Bowl Series XIII is hurtling towards its climax, and Week 08–09 delivered nothing short of breathtaking drama as teams battled for a place in the playoffs.

Fans filled Showtime Arena in their numbers, cheering on every daring move, while over 100,000 viewers tuned in online, making it one of the most-watched flag football weekends this season.

The action began with Lekki Braves narrowly defeating Lagos Alpha Flag Football, 22-19. Both teams, sitting 7th and 8th in the standings, remain out of playoff contention, but the game demonstrated their fighting spirit and left fans buzzing in anticipation of next season.

In the next clash, Greenbacks Flag Football stunned the Mainland Long Horns with a commanding 45-6 victory, keeping their faint playoff hopes alive while consigning Long Horns to a continued struggle at the bottom.

The Lagos Raptors made a decisive statement with a 26-14 win over Ikan Sports, securing their playoff position and sending a message that they are a serious contender heading into the finals. Raptors’ fans erupted in celebration as their team ensured a spot in the coveted top six.

The biggest drama came in the 08–09 Week “Clash of Titans” matchups:

Lagos Athletic Knights, the only undefeated team of the season, survived a nail-biting 43-41 thriller against Panthers Sports, keeping their perfect record intact. With the Knights now firmly at the top, all eyes are on them as potential champions.

Warriors Flag Football crushed the Lagos Rebels 49-14, holding onto second place and reinforcing their status as serious contenders for the title.

With six teams now in the hunt for playoff glory, the tension could not be higher. LA Knights remain unbeaten, Warriors in second, Panthers and Raptors locked in the playoff battle, and the final two spots now up for grabs — every point matters in the run-up to the season finale.

Sunday’s games showcased why Showtime Flag Football has become Nigeria’s premier platform for professional co-ed football. From explosive touchdowns to last-minute heroics, the league continues to thrill fans while providing Nigerian athletes the opportunity to showcase their talent on a growing global stage.
